Guddu power plant fire; Addition of 1747 MW to the shortfall

 The current energy crisis in the country is likely to intensify further.


After the Neelum-Jhelum hydroelectric project, power from the Guddu power station also flowed into the national grid, after which the energy crisis in the country is likely to deepen.

The fire at the Guddu power station has dumped 1,747 MW of electricity into the national grid and the deficit has increased further, likely to further aggravate the energy crisis in the country.

The Power Division has informed the Prime Minister about the fire incident at Guddu Power Plant.

On the other hand, the Neelum Neelum Jhelum Hydel power project is out of the 969 MW power system due to a tunnel failure. The fault in the tunnel of the project has not been fixed yet, the fault will be fixed after the complete cleaning of the tunnel, it may take another 15 to 20 days.
